Eagles use balanced offense, beat Crusaders 10-0.

Pine Forest took to the air on Thursday, surprisngly, to knock off Catholic in the Kick-Off Classic.

Junior quarterback David Lawrence, who only had two pass attempts the entire first half, put together four straight passes on the opening possession of the second half, including a 15-yard touchdown strike, to give Pine Forest their only touchdown of the game.

The Pine Forest defense would take over for the remainder of the game, holding on dearly to that 10-0 lead.

The Eagles held the Crusaders to -11 yards for the scrimmage.

Pine Forest starts their season off with a clash with Pace on Friday, while Catholic plays host to Northview.
